Why Is There A Dearth Of Women In Data Science

This article investigates the reasons behind the scarcity of women in data science, including the gender pay gap, limited career growth, male-dominated culture, and lack of mentorship. It notes that despite women comprising 55% of university graduates, only a small percentage enter data science (15-22%). Societal stereotypes, a perception of the field as theoretical and competitive, and workplace issues like bullying also contribute. The author suggests promoting STEM education for girls and addressing biases in recruitment and promotion to foster inclusivity.
